Golf courses and port facilities in Busan (ranging from Haeundae Beach resorts to Gijang-gun country clubs and the Port of Busan logistics zones) operate continuously in high-humidity, high-salinity air. Standard electric vehicle chargers suffer accelerated corrosion, circuit failures, and efficiency drops due to moisture ingress and salt-crust deposition on internal PCBs. Our specific line of IP67-rated waterproof and hermetically sealed chargers prevents saline micro-particles from entering the internal electronics, guaranteeing a longer lifespan even in oceanfront applications.
Unlike flat inland courses, golf resorts in the Busan and Gyeongsangnam-do regions are built into mountainous coastal ranges. Golf carts operating on these courses experience higher average discharge rates and deeper battery depletion profiles due to continuous hill climbs. This demands charging equipment that can dynamically analyze battery health, manage thermal spikes, and apply intelligent multi-stage charging algorithms (such as constant-current, constant-voltage, and trickle charging) to restore capacity safely without overheating or degrading the cells.

Our chargers implement advanced LLC resonant converter technology to achieve soft-switching operation. This limits power losses, reduces electromagnetic interference (EMI), and raises efficiency up to 94%, reducing operating costs for high-density fleets.
Ensures real-time communication between the charger and the battery's BMS. The charger continuously reads parameters like cell temperature, voltage, and SOC, adjusting output dynamically to prevent overcharging or thermal runaway.
Engineered with pre-programmed charging profiles for both traditional deep-cycle Lead-Acid (AGM/Gel) batteries and advanced Lithium-ion (LiFePO4) chemistry. Operators can safely toggle curves depending on fleet modernization phases.

Electric vehicle components, including high-power chargers, must meet national safety and EMI standards enforced by the Korean Agency for Technology and Standards (KATS). Our exporting products are designed to meet standard Korean test parameters:
• Safety: KC 60335-1 & KC 60335-2-29
• EMC/EMI: KC 32 & KC 35 (equivalent to KN 32/35 CISPR standards)
This ensures that our chargers do not introduce dangerous high-frequency interference to other electronic equipment in resort clubhouses or port terminals.
